Bitcoin miner Marathon Digital has been fined $138 million for breach of confidentiality or non-circumvention agreement. Michael Ho, former co-founder of US Bitcoin Corp and chief strategy officer of mining firm Hut 8, has won a unanimous verdict from a jury in a breach of contract lawsuit against Marathon Digital Holdings.
